The social effects of job-sharing are likely to be beneficial, since it attempts to match work opportunities to a wider variety of lifestyles. The combination of one full-time and one part-time spouse might become much more common:which was the husband and which was the wife would vary according to taste,time of life and career requirements.
What exactly is job-sharing? The Equal Opportunities Commission defines it as“a form of part-time employment where two people voluntarily share the responsibility of one full-time position. ”Salary and benefits are divided between the two sharers. Each person’s terms and conditions of employment are the same as those of a full-timer. If each works at least 15 hours a week, then they enjoy certain employment rights that ordinary part-time workers do not have.
Part-timers usually earn less per hour than a full-timer, and have fewer benefits and less job security. They have virtually no career prospects. Employers often think that working part-time means hat a person has no ambitions and so offer no chance of promotion.
But job-sharing bridges that gap and offers the chance of interesting work to people who can only work part-time and that does not mean just married women. As Adrienne Broyle of“New Ways to Work”—formerly the London Job-sharing Project points out:“There are various reasons why people decide they want to job-share and so have more free time”.
“A growing number of men want to job-share so that they can play an active role in bringing up their children. It allows people to study at home in their free time,and means that disabled people of those who otherwise stay at home to look after them, can work. Job-sharing is also an ideal way for people to ease into retirement”.
